Profile snapshot

Aaron Hickey is listed with #2 Defender, Scotland, 23 years old, and 178 at Brentford. These identifiers frame the player profile, position, squad number, nationality and current club before moving into match and stat context.

Current season stats

For Premier League 2025/26, Aaron Hickey's tracked stats include 21 matches, 727 minutes, 0 goals, 0 assists, 0.6 xG, and 0.0 xA. This gives the page useful coverage for player stats, goals, assists, minutes, goalkeeper metrics, expected goals and expected assists when those values are available.
